Executive Sous Chef
Role Summary
Reporting to the Director of Food and Beverage, the Executive Sous Chef is accountable for the overall success of daily kitchen operations. This role demonstrates advanced culinary expertise, operational leadership, and a commitment to luxury service standards aligned with JW Marriott and LQA expectations.
The Executive Sous Chef leads by example, actively participating in food preparation while guiding the culinary team to deliver consistent, high-quality products across all outlets. This position is responsible for enhancing both guest and associate satisfaction while driving strong financial performance. Oversight includes all food production areas (banquets, restaurants, in-room dining, lounges, and associate dining) as well as stewarding and purchasing functions.

Requirements
- Red Seal Certification required Minimum 6 years of progressive culinary experience in a hotel, resort, or luxury environmentOR 2-year degree in Culinary Arts, Hospitality Management, or a related field, with 4 years of relevant experience
- Strong understanding of luxury hospitality standards (LQA experience considered an asset) Proven ability to lead high-performing teams in a fast-paced environment
- Advanced culinary knowledge, including modern techniques and global cuisine trends
- Strong financial acumen related to food cost control and budgeting Excellent communication, leadership, and organizational skills
Working Conditions
- Ability to work in diverse environments, including hot, humid, and cold conditions Flexibility to work evenings, weekends, and holidays as required
- Ability to lift, carry, push, or pull up to 50 pounds without assistance
- Capable of standing, walking, bending, and working for extended periods
- Ability to navigate wet and slippery surfaces safely
